微信小程序作为一种全新的应用型小程序服务模式,早在2017年便作为移动互联网的重要组成部分已经发展起来。然而,随着日益增长的用户量及需要升级开发工具,微信小程序开发中经常会出现各种问题,例如开发工具滑动白屏问题。
一、问题表现
开发者在使用微信小程序开发工具进行开发时,经常会出现滑动白屏的问题。这个问题往往在手机设备预览或者使用开发环境内置调试工具时出现。
问题表现为:当我们引入外部 CSS 样式及微信自带样式时,在微信开发工具调试时,出现 UI 滑动白屏,不能滑动页面。
二、问题原因
1.开发工具:微信小程序开发工具的功能以及负载等方面的原因,是出现此类问题的主要原因之一。
2.代码问题:我们的程序代码中可能存在某些语法错误,或者使用了某些不规范的语法,导致程序出现问题。
3.样式问题:在前端开发中,使用 CSS 样式文件是必不可少的一部分,我们在编写 CSS 时,会遇到各种浏览器兼容性问题,导致滑动白屏的问题出现。
三、解决方法
1.开发者工具缓存:首先,我们需要清理一下微信小程序开发工具的缓存。清理缓存可以解决程序运行时可能遇到的一些 bug 和问题。
2.升级开发工具版本:如果你的微信开发工具过于陈旧,可能会存在一些 bug 或兼容性问题,所以建议及时升级开发工具的版本。
3.检查代码:检查代码中的语法错误,并优化程序代码,给程序扫一下代码规范的问题,减少代码冗余度,这对于程序的性能和体验都非常有好处。
4.修改 CSS 文件:修改 CSS 样式文件,尽可能减少使用一些低效率的样式,避免在页面滚动时出现卡顿现象。
5.减少图片资源:渲染过多的图片资源也容易引起滑动白屏问题,因此应该尽量减少使用一些不必要的图片资源,采用背景色等方法来减少图片的渲染。
综上所述,微信小程序开发过程中出现滑动白屏问题,并非只有一种原因,需要进行综合分析和检查。如果出现滑动白屏问题,可以通过技术手段逐一排查,确保程序在用户体验和性能方面达到良好的表现。